The comic version should win as the comic versions of the Justice League are much more powerful than the animated versions. Also JLU Amazo has shown a weakness to magic, while comic Amazo has shown the ability to copy it as well as no limits to his copying (Worligog). He's blitzed flash, taken on the entire Justice League at once, multiple times, and written correctly would be unstoppable. Also part of his makeup is to not only copy abilities but to amplify them beyond their original level and to even supposedly take the thoughts and minds of people he copies, so he would technically have the strategies of Batman and Superman, functioning at Flash speeds.
